I know it only as a variant of aiki-jujutsu. The prefix "bu" indicates that the school makes spiritual teachings an important part of the curriculum, and tries to apply the martial art to one's entire life. The evolution is Jujitsu ---> aiki-jujitsu ---> aiki-bujutsu ---> aiki-budo ---> aikido.
